Key Differences
In short — GeForce RTX 3060 8 GB outperforms GeForce GTX 1660 Ti Max-Q on the selected game parameters. We do not have the prices of both CPUs to compare value. The better performing GeForce RTX 3060 8 GB is 1268 days newer than GeForce GTX 1660 Ti Max-Q.
Advantages of NVIDIA GeForce RTX 3060 8 GB
- Performs up to 22% better in Stray than GeForce GTX 1660 Ti Max-Q - 88 vs 72 FPS
- Up to 33% more VRAM memory than NVIDIA GeForce GTX 1660 Ti Max-Q - 8 vs 6 GB

NVIDIA GeForce GTX 1660 Ti Max-Q | vs | NVIDIA GeForce RTX 3060 8 GB |
---|---|---|
Apr 23rd, 2019 | Release Date | Oct 12th, 2022 |
GeForce 16 Mobile | Generation | GeForce 30 |
Not Available | MSRP | Not Available |
None | Outputs | 1x HDMI 2.1, 3x DisplayPort 1.4a |
None | Power Connectors | 1x 12-pin |
Mobile | Segment | Desktop |
6 GB | Memory | 8 GB |
GDDR6 | Type | GDDR6 |
192-bit | Bus | 128-bit |
288 GB/s | Bandwidth | 240 GB/s |
1140 MHz | Base Clock Speed | 1320 MHz |
1335 MHz | Boost Clock Speed | 1777 MHz |
1500 MHz | Memory Clock Speed | 1875 MHz |
